How much is a chicken in the US?

In the United States, the price for a pound of fresh whole chicken cost consumers an average of just over one U.S. dollar and a half in 2021, which constituted a slight decrease from a price peak in 2020.

How much has the price of chicken increased?

Chicken prices nationwide have increased 16.4% in the year to April, according to the Consumer Price Index. And pointing to the ongoing bird flu outbreak, the U.S. Department of Agriculture predicts wholesale poultry prices will increase 15-18% this year.

How much does a full chicken cost?

According to the USDA, whole chicken currently averages $1.28 per pound nationwide, which is considerably less expensive than boneless individual pieces, like thighs and breasts. The price is low because you’re not paying for someone to take the time to butcher it.

How much is a pound of chicken in 2021?

3.73 U.S. dollars
In 2021, the price for one pound of boneless chicken breast in the United States amounted to 3.73 U.S. dollars, the highest price for the period under consideration. Over the past 14 years, the retail price had remained between three and three and a half U.S. dollars per pound in the country.

What is happening to chicken prices?

Prices for the world’s most consumed meat have been surging in recent months. Retail whole chickens in the US cost $1.79 per pound in April, the highest price in 15 years of records and about 19% more than their 10-year average.

Why is chicken so expensive 2022?

The USDA Livestock, Dairy and Poultry Outlook for May 2022 noted that poultry production nationwide has steadily increased following supply chain disruptions during the pandemic. But, so have prices. Rising production costs, particularly feed and fuel, have driven up grocery store prices for consumers.

Why are chicken prices doubled?

Wholesale chicken prices continue to rise in the US as demand from restaurants pressures supplies of certain poultry cuts. Consumers may notice higher prices on poultry products, especially cuts like boneless chicken breasts, due to surging demand, lower supplies and higher feed costs.
